Understanding Psychometric Analysis


Psychometric analysis involves evaluating key psychological attributes such as personality traits, cognitive abilities, and behavioural tendencies. This objective and in-depth approach uncovers characteristics that are often not visible through traditional methods, helping us identify candidates who are most likely to succeed in their roles and contribute positively to the workplace. Through psychometric testing and behavioural assessments, we provide a detailed profile of the candidate that goes beyond surface-level qualifications.


The Profile: Visualising Personality and Behavior

The Profile is the first visual output from our psychometric analysis, providing an overview of a candidate’s temperament and natural behaviour patterns. It offers a snapshot of how they typically behave in various situations and how their current circumstances may influence their actions. This helps us understand how a candidate might respond to challenges, adapt to new roles, and manage stress or change—insights that are invaluable for long-term success.


Interpretation Report: Strengths and Development Areas

The Interpretation Report takes a deeper look at the candidate’s potential assets, areas for development, and how they are adjusting to their current situation. This report helps predict a candidate’s future performance by identifying their natural tendencies and any possible behavioural changes based on their environment. It’s an essential tool for assessing whether a candidate will thrive in your organisation’s culture and meet its goals.


Leadership Profile: Assessing Leadership Potential

For candidates in or aspiring to leadership roles, the Leadership Profile summarises their likely behaviour in leadership positions. It provides insights into their decision-making processes, leadership style, and how they motivate and manage teams. This profile is particularly useful when considering a candidate for managerial responsibilities, as it highlights how they might perform in situations requiring strategic thinking, team management, and problem-solving.


Selling Style: Evaluating Persuasion and Influence

The Selling Style report outlines how a candidate is likely to behave in roles that require persuasion, negotiation, or influencing others. Whether the position requires direct sales or the ability to sell ideas or solutions, this report assesses a candidate’s potential to succeed in environments where communication and persuasion are key to success.

Managing and Coaching: Tools for Leadership and Development

Management Overview

The Management Overview report provides a snapshot of the candidate’s profile for ongoing reference. This quick guide helps managers understand a candidate’s natural behaviour and potential challenges, offering a foundation for deeper engagement and feedback. For effective management, it is crucial to align the candidate’s natural tendencies with the leadership style and expectations of the organisation.


Motivating Factors

Every candidate is driven by different internal factors, and understanding these motivating factors is key to fostering job satisfaction and performance. This report identifies what motivates the candidate and evaluates whether those needs are being met in their current role. It also helps assess whether a potential new role would align with these intrinsic drivers.


Strategies for Coaching and Developing

The Strategies for Coaching and Developing report provides actionable insights on how to work effectively with a candidate. This includes guidance on leveraging their strengths, addressing areas for development, and tailoring coaching strategies to their specific needs. When combined with the management overview, this report helps managers understand how to nurture their teams and optimise their performance.


Developmental Learning Style

Understanding a candidate’s preferred developmental learning style is critical for designing effective training and onboarding programs. This report provides insights into how candidates learn best—whether they prefer hands-on experience, formal courses, or structured mentorship—enabling tailored training strategies that maximise growth and development.



 
Collaboration and Compatibility

Team Approach

Effective collaboration within teams is essential for business success, and the Team Approach report sheds light on how a candidate works in group settings. By comparing their profile with that of other team members, you can assess compatibility and gain a deeper understanding of your team’s dynamics. This is particularly valuable when onboarding new employees, as it allows you to anticipate how they will interact with existing team members and contribute to overall team success.
